Clan: C2H2-zf (CL0361)

Summary

Classical C2H2 and C2HC zinc fingers Add an annotation

Superfamily of classical and closely related C2H2 or beta-beta-alpha zinc finger DNA-binding domains.

This clan contains 52 families and the total number of domains in the clan is 1469608. The clan was built by P Coggill.
